Welcome to Brentwood, California
Located in Region 9.
The County is Contra Costa.
The city has over 48,000 residents living in 11.66 square miles of area.
The city was incorporated in January 1948 or 1958.
The city is located in Northern California.
Some Interesting facts about Brentwood, California.
Founded in 1878 when the San Pablo & Tulare Railroad came through the east of Contra Costa this city enjoys an agricultural feast as they have Harvest Season when the area produces corn and fresh fruit like peaches, apricots, plums, pluots and cherries oh Logic can taste them right now. This city is afforded breath taking mountain views of Mount Diablo (Devils Mountain).

Welcome to Brea, California
Located in Region 5.
The County is Orange.
The city has nearly 40,000 residents living in 10.5 square miles of area.
The city was incorporated in February 1917.
The city is located in Southern California.
Some Interesting facts about Brea, California.
Logic was born and grew up one city away in Fullerton, California (ok interesting to me) however what we like most about Brea starts with the history of the oil and the oil derricks that remain in the Brea Canyon right off of Brea Canyon Road in the north end of the city these giant derricks are worth the visit as a kind of history of oil and in fact these were sold in the late 1800’s to a little known company named Union Oil Company better known today as Unical or Union 76 you know the gas stations with the rotating orange 76 ball. Brea was home to Union Oil until it was sold to another oil giant later.

Welcome to Brawley, California.
Located in Region 2.
The County is Imperial.
The city has nearly 26,000 residents living in 5.8 square miles of area.
The city was incorporated in April 1908.
The city is located in Southern California.
Some Interesting facts about Brawley, California.
Brawley is located below sea level and is located just south of the south end of the State of California’s largest lake the Salton Sea. Welcome to Bradbury, California.
Located in Region 9.
The County is Los Angeles.
The city has only a little more the 800 residents living in 1.91 square miles of area.
The city was incorporated in July 1957.
the city is located in southern California.
Some Interesting facts about Bradbury, California.
Located in the foothills of the San Gabriel Mountains is perhaps why a city in the highest population city in California Los Angeles is why this city has fewer then 1000 residents a very peaceful city compared the concrete jungle of downtown Los Angeles. The city is also at the start of the Angeles National Forest. Most residents live on 2 and 5 acres parcels reducing population density.
